The best and esiest thing I have found to use for foundation piecing (paper piecing) is light weight pellon. Get the most sheer one you can find, cut square the size desired and sew on the strips of fabric. Turn the block and square up. This works for me so much better than using fabric for the base and it is less bulky. Don't worry if the pellon does not come to edge of fabric in some spots along edges of block. Sometimes sewing will shrink the pellon a little depending the kind of fabric used
